Very strong opinions there buddy but very far from facts -_-. Tuners are tuners not magicians so If cars have other mechanical/electrical problems is not their fault if they decline to tune because you need other work. From my experience Alpha has been the dude messing with my tune and has been great all around specially with consultation and customer service 100% when I need him. Right now he's going through the death of his fiance so you will have to check when he can tune your car. I have dealt with Neal Sutton hes a good tuner and always easy to get a hold of and helpful with services you need. I have also dealt and seen many cars that Jap has tuned and in real life have never heard bad things from his TUNING. I always hear people taking shots at john vega but again in real life i see a lot of his customers happy and cars running hard. Now all those other no name newbie tuners i would be careful with a tune is not something to cheap out on or have people practicing with your setup.
